Coffer Corporate Leisure relaunches as Portland Leisure Advisers

Coffer Corporate Leisure, the leisure focused property investment and M&A boutique, has relaunched as Portland Leisure Advisers after leaving the Coffer Group.

Coffer Corporate Leisure was founded by Mark Sheehan and David Coffer 19 years ago as a standalone vehicle within the Coffer Group, quickly establishing itself on the back of big sale and leasebacks for Little Chef and LA Fitness and the sale of Patisserie Valerie. It has always worked closely with leisure agency Davis Coffer Lyons and will continue to do so in its next incarnation.

Sheehan said: “We are relaunching outside of Coffer Group and assuming ownership but will continue a very close relationship with Davis Coffer Lyons on the occupational side.”

He said that Portland, which takes its name from Coffer Group’s Portland Place offices, will continue to offer the same specialist investment advice to the leisure and alternative sectors.

Sheehan was among those to pay tribute to David Coffer, who died last month, describing him as “the most supportive and loyal person”.

Sheehan will run Portland with fellow directors Lawrence Telford and Jack Silvani and associate director Jack Higgitt.

Speaking for Coffer Group, Adam Coffer said: “This is a natural progression which has been planned many months. Our working relationship will continue to be as strong as ever. It has been and will continue to be a potent alliance.”
